Output 64f834f3b8d361ee73050d48cf217a5d69f19bb17c109584d33d75a3f3226f99:3

value
508087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c59486c93d7174068119457fdee5ce429e25ba7 OP_EQUAL
address
3QhKANRPaXvjGG1WY8rqTMPJQZkJudRyVw
transaction
64f834f3b8d361ee73050d48cf217a5d69f19bb17c109584d33d75a3f3226f99
spent
true